Picnik
Just stumbled into picnik, an online photo editor. It uses the Flickr/Picasa/Facebook API’s to access your online photo collections. It’s free during the beta period and after that, there probably will be a free and a payed version.

I’m one of 6589
The Dutch Tax Administration offers tax-reporting software for Windows, OS X and Linux. Out of 5.700.000 taxreports in total, only 6589 taxreports were done on Linux.
